Welcome to the FreshFold on-call rotation! Quick primer on the laundry-locker access flow: when a customer scans their drop code, Lockhub pings the kiosk, unlocks the bay, and logs the event to the Tumbler queue. If the bay doesn't open within five seconds, the kiosk retries twice, then falls back to attendant override. Most pages you'll get are stale override tokens — nothing scary. The full flow diagram, failure states, and reset steps live on the internal page here:

wiki page, tahaf-tajog: https://jira.ordindyn.corp/pipeline

### Account Recovery — LedgerLens Audit-Log Viewer

If the LedgerLens service account at Coppervale Analytics is locked out, do not recreate it; historical log signatures depend on its key. Instead, run the recovery flow from the bastion host and choose "restore existing identity." When prompted, supply the recovery passphrase recorded below.

vault phrase of kawef-yahop = wenir-jorox-druys-belion-kelion-lamvan-frawyn-norael-julox-raleth-rusax-oliys-holael

Subject: Skylark-9 drone returned for servicing

Dispatch desk,

The Skylark-9 unit from the Pellworth survey team came back this morning with a cracked rotor housing and an intermittent gimbal fault. It has been powered down, battery removed, and packed in its original transit case. Halden Aero Services will send a courier tomorrow between 09:00 and 11:00 to collect it for repair. Please log the case weight before release and keep the battery here. The courier hand-over must follow the confidential instruction below:

handover note for yagef-bagep: the drudor pelius courier leaves the kasdor zorvan norir ledger at gate 8016 under passcode 755406